Fiona Dawson is an Emmy®-nominated filmmaker, author, and dynamic keynote speaker who brings over two decades of experience working across corporate, nonprofit, and global communities. Known for her compelling storytelling style, Fiona weaves personal narrative with research and real-world insights to explore the intersection of LGBTQIA+ identity, disability, leadership, and culture. She is also the creator and host of OUT with Fiona, a series presented by PBS that was picked up by Austin PBS, spotlighting stories of kindness and courage from across the LGBTQIA2S+ community.
